The Karate Kid

Year: 1984

Rating: PG

Tagline: "Only the 'Old One' could teach him the secrets of the masters."

Reasons they need to see it: Do your kids a favour and don't show them the most recent remake of this classic. Ralph Macchio and Pat Morita are the masters, and their relationship is one for the ages. Full of positive role models and messages — like respecting your elders and working hard — this one will teach your kids a lot.

What to watch out for: While this one is mostly full of good, clean fun, the whole reason Daniel starts to learn karate is because he's been a victim of bullying, so expect some fist fights that have nothing to do with martial arts. There's also the appearance of weed once, and Mr. Miyagi gets drunk.
